SAN ANTONIO — A bicyclist was injured early Sunday morning after being hit by a driver that fled the scene on the south side of town, according to San Antonio police.
The crash happened just after midnight in the 6900 block of South Flores near Division Avenue. Police say a 43-year-old man was riding his bike in the southeast lanes when he heard a vehicle honking behind him. Moments later, an unknown vehicle hit the back of his bicycle, throwing him to the ground.
The driver did not stop or provide aid, police said. The victim suffered non-life-threatening injuries and was taken to a local hospital for treatment.
Investigators currently have no description of the vehicle or driver. The case remains active, and police say all information is preliminary and subject to change as the investigation continues.
